1. d4 d6 2. Nf3 Bg4 3. c4 Bxf3 4. exf3 Nd7 5. Be2 g6 6. O-O Bg7 7. Nc3 Nh6 8. g4 e6 9. Be3 f5 10. Re1 O-O 11. g5 Nf7 12. f4 c6 13. Qd2 Qc7 14. Rad1 Rad8 15. h4 Rfe8 16. h5 Nf8 17. h6 Bh8 18. Qc1 e5 19. d5 c5 20. Kg2 Rd7 21. Bf1 Qd8 22. fxe5 dxe5 23. f4 b6 24. a3 Nd6 25. b4 exf4 26. Bxf4 Ne4 27. Nxe4 fxe4 28. Kh1 Rf7 29. Bh3 Bd4 30. Re2 e3 31. Rf1 Qe7 32. d6 Qe4+ 33. Bg2 Qd3 34. Ree1 e2 35. Rf3 Qe4 36. Rf2 Qd3 37. Rf3 Qe4 38. Qd2 Rf5 39. Rf2 Be3 40. Bxe4 Bxd2 41. Rexe2 Rxf4 42. Rxf4 Bxf4 43. Bd5+ Ne6 44. d7 1–0

This chess game between Laszlo Dr. Eperjesi (2370) and Thomas Bree (2252) was played at FSIMA October in 2000 and finished 1–0. The opening was the Queen's Pawn Game (A41).
